A jinbaori (surcoat)

19th century
The white cotton coat cut with straight sleeve openings and applied with a black-velvet Tokugawa family crest on two horizontal bands on the reverse, the epaulets black velvet with gold and green stitching and the facing and interior brocade designed with confronted dragons, phoenixes and floral roundels 41 3/4in (106cm) long
